Abstract

Glyphosate (Roundup TM) is an acid
in salt form used as a herbicide
broad-spectrum systemic, being effective
and economic field was opened in agriculture
and world horticulture, developing
genetic varieties resistant to its use and
increasing exposure to soil, air and
water, although it is only aimed at plants,
fungi and bacteria, in recent times
have discovered health repercussions
human, from reproductive alterations,
endocrinological, even neuronal defects
that predispose spectrum disorders
autistic (ASD).
